
Nikki Haley is a candidate in the 2024 presidential election. She is running for the Republican nomination.
Haley announced her candidacy on February 13, 2023.
Haley served in the South Carolina House of Representatives from 2005 to 2011 before being elected Governor of South Carolina in 2011, an office she held until 2017. In 2017, President Trump appointed Haley U.S. ambassador to the United Nations. Haley resigned from the position in December, 2018.
